In the dynamic world of mobile app development, Flutter has emerged as a powerful framework for building high-performance, cross-platform applications. Developed by Google, Flutter enables developers to create visually appealing and natively compiled applications for mobile, web, and desktop from a single codebase. This blog delves into the Flutter app development process, guiding you from the initial concept to the successful launch of your app.
Conceptualization: Defining the VisionThe journey of a Flutter app begins with a clear vision and well-defined objectives:
Identify the Problem:
Understand the problem your app aims to solve or the need it intends to fulfill. This sets the foundation for the app’s purpose and functionality.
Target Audience:
Determine who will use your app. Knowing your target audience’s demographics, preferences, and behaviors helps tailor the app to meet their needs.
Unique Value Proposition:
Identify what makes your app unique. What features or services does it offer that competitors don’t? This will guide your development and marketing strategies.
Thorough research and meticulous planning are crucial for the success of your Flutter app:
Market Research:
Conduct comprehensive market research to understand the competitive landscape. Identify existing solutions and pinpoint opportunities for differentiation.
Technical Feasibility:
Assess the technical requirements and feasibility of your app. Determine which platforms (iOS, Android, web, desktop) you will develop for using Flutter’s cross-platform capabilities.
Project Roadmap:
Develop a detailed project roadmap outlining the development timeline, key milestones, and deliverables. This keeps the project on track and ensures timely progress.
Wireframing and prototyping are essential steps in visualizing the app’s structure and functionality:
Wireframes:
Create wireframes to map out the app’s layout and user interface. Wireframes provide a visual representation of the app’s screens and navigation flow, helping identify potential usability issues early on.
Interactive Prototypes:
Develop interactive prototypes to simulate the app’s functionality. Prototypes allow for early testing and feedback, ensuring the design meets user expectations.
User interface (UI) and user experience (UX) design are critical to creating an engaging and intuitive app:
UI Design:
Focus on creating a visually appealing interface that aligns with your brand identity. Flutter’s rich set of customizable widgets allows for creating beautiful and responsive designs.
UX Design:
Ensure the app provides a seamless and enjoyable user experience. Design intuitive navigation, clear call-to-action buttons, and user-friendly interactions to enhance usability.
The development phase involves translating the design into a functional app using Flutter’s capabilities:
Choosing the Right Tools:
Utilize Flutter’s development environment, which includes Dart language and tools like Android Studio or Visual Studio Code. These tools streamline the development process and enhance productivity.
Backend Development:
Develop the server, database, and APIs that support the app’s functionality. Ensure the backend is secure, scalable, and efficient.
Frontend Development:
Build the app’s front end using Flutter’s rich set of pre-designed widgets. Flutter’s hot reload feature allows for real-time changes and rapid iteration.
Integration:
Integrate third-party services and APIs as needed, such as payment gateways, social media logins, or analytics tools.
Rigorous testing ensures the app functions correctly and provides a positive user experience:
Functional Testing:
Verify that all features and functionalities work as intended. Test various scenarios and edge cases to ensure robustness.
Usability Testing:
Assess the app’s usability and user experience. Identify any issues that could hinder user satisfaction and retention.
Performance Testing:
Test the app’s performance under different conditions, including load testing to ensure it can handle a large number of users.
Security Testing:
Identify and address any security vulnerabilities to protect user data and ensure compliance with regulations.
Beta Testing:
Release the app to a select group of users for beta testing. Gather feedback and make necessary adjustments before the official launch.
Once the app has passed all tests and is ready for launch:
App Store Preparation:
Ensure all app store guidelines are met for a smooth approval process. Create a compelling app description, screenshots, and promotional materials.
Publishing:
Submit the app to the Google Play Store and Apple App Store. The review process can take several days, so plan accordingly.
Marketing and Promotion:
Develop a marketing strategy to promote the app. Utilize social media, content marketing, email campaigns, and paid advertising to reach your target audience.
The launch of your app is just the beginning. Ongoing support and maintenance are crucial for sustained success:
Monitoring and Analytics:
Use analytics tools to monitor user behavior, app performance, and key metrics. This data provides valuable insights for future updates and improvements.
User Feedback:
Continuously collect and analyze user feedback through reviews, surveys, and direct communication. Address any issues or concerns promptly to maintain a positive user experience.
Regular Updates:
Release regular updates to fix bugs, improve performance, and add new features. Keep the app relevant and engaging for users.
Scalability:
As the user base grows, ensure your backend infrastructure can scale to handle increased demand. Optimize performance to maintain a seamless user experience.
